A funny bug I wanted to share.
You know how holy orders aren't allowed to be used in combat against fellow Catholics? Well that's a great feature and all, on paper I find this a very creative mechanic.
Thing is, they still can and WILL 'assault' catholic forts in any war. Given the bulk of my casualties tend to come from assaults, when I realized this I figure this one needs to be squashed. As things stand, you can raise 15K worth of mobile Battering Rams for 250 piety to assault all enemy fortifications while your levies keep the troops at bay :blink:
Of course I couldn't get myself to seriously abuse this, but given my tendency to merge alot of stuff into stacks, I might have done so accidentally at a point or two before I noticed.
